What You'll Do
- →As senior duty manager, assists supervisor in the accomplishment of work by other duty managers and evaluates security related activities for security operations.
- →Assist manager by insuring adequate staffing of operations with personnel and the protection of users.
- →Carries out work in accordance with policies, regulations, directives, and requirements.
- →Inspects facilities and reports on results.
- →Exercises judgment on routine matters where discretion is permitted.
- →Ensures that the organization's strategic plan, mission, vision and values are communicated to the team and integrated into the team's strategies, goals, objectives, work plans and work products and services.
- →Supports the management team in decision making and responding to concerns of guests and users.
- →Leads staff as required in the performance of their duties by providing coaching, directing, mentoring, training, monitoring and evaluating.
- →Distributes and balances workload and tasks among staff in accordance with established work flows, skill level and/or occupational specialization, making adjustments to accomplish the workload in accordance with established priorities to ensure timely accomplishment of assigned team tasks and ensuring that each staff member has an integral role in developing a final team product.
- →Reports on the status of progress of work, checking on work in progress and reviewing completed work to see that the manager's instructions on work priorities, methods, deadlines and quality have been met.
- →Keeps manager informed of events or items of significance,.
- →Enforces and carries out policy and requirements.
- →Responsible for the safeguarding and protection of funds, property and personnel.
- →Attends and or arranges for the conduct of security and emergency response training.
